Ballarat Film Society | To Thank the Room

Award Winning Australian Documentary

Best Melbourne Documentary 2024 at the Melbourne Documentary Film Festival, To Thank the Room is about the last 100 days of the iconic Brooklyn Arts Hotel in Fitzroy.
This heart-warming and inspiring documentary is an intimate portrait of Maggie Fooke, the creator of the hotel, as she navigates the final days of this dearly-loved institution, before its closure in 2020 due to financial constraints.
To Thank The Room is about living life to the fullest and facing major life-transitions. Maggie leads a merry dance as she both embraces and resists the process of letting go, with a fierce determination to relish and share her beloved ‘Brooklyn’ to the very last drop. (She now presides over the Northern Arts guest house in Castlemaine, which hosts a rich programme of music and film events). ‘So few films try to capture everyday life, and few succeed as this one has. I enjoyed it so much. Just beautiful’ – John Flaus – Australian screen and broadcasting legend. Kind Films.
Australia, 2023, 77 mins.
Plus 30 mins for Q&A with director Belinda Lloyd and Maggie Fooke.
